James R. Hoffa became a Teamster member in 1934 and served as General President for 14 years, and, in recognition of his tireless service to the Union and its members, was honored as General President Emeritus for life. At the November 1999 General Executive Board meeting, General Secretary-Treasurer C. Thomas Keegel presented a resolution to establish the new scholarship fund. This site describes the James R. Hoffa Memorial Scholarship Fund (JRHMSF) and outlines eligibility requirements and application procedures. The 2012/2013 scholarship for high school seniors begins in November 2011 with a deadline of March 31, 2012.
The 2011 Essay Contest will begin in July 2012.
The James R Hoffa Memorial Scholarship Fund is an independent organization established and registered as a tax exempt entity under Section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code. The Fund is established solely to provide scholarships to the children and dependents of members of the International Brotherhood of Teamsters, and contributions to the Fund are deductible as charitable contributions to the extent permitted by law. The International Union provides certain in kind services to the Fund, such as this portion of the union web site, in order to benefit members and their children and dependents.
Joint Council 25 Covers Early Fees for First 1,500 Applicants
Teamsters Joint Council 25 needs 1,500 applications to establish the first-ever specialty license plates honoring Teamster men and women across Illinois.
Teamster members and supporters simply need to complete the attached application form and return it to the Joint Council to secure the new license plates. Joint Council 25 will cover a $25 registration fee for the first 1,500 applicants and help members get one step closer to taking their union pride on the road.

“The Teamsters license plate not only reminds everyone on the road of the strength of our union, but it offers Illinois drivers a special designation to call their own,” said John T. Coli, President of Joint Council 25. “At no cost, Teamsters and their families can help guarantee Illinois residents recognize our union on every street and highway statewide.”
After Joint Council 25 receives 1,500 completed applications, the Secretary of State’s office will begin producing the specialty license plates. Applicants will be notified when plates become available. It will only cost $15 for applicants to pick up their final license plates; anyone who registers after the first 1,500 applications have been submitted will have to pay $40.
“All you have to do is fill out your application and return it to the Joint Council; it’s that simple,” said Coli. “It only takes a minute to complete the process and show your Teamster Pride.”
Please return completed applications to the Joint Council. Completed forms may be faxed to (847) 292-1412 or e-mailed to Will Petty at will@chicagoteamsters.org.

A majority of all funds raised by the specialty license plates will be donated to the Teamsters Joint Council 25 Charitable Trust.

The Chicago Federation of Labor will offer five (5) academic-based scholarships and five (5) random-drawing scholarships in the amount of $2,000 to students graduating from a Chicago or suburban high school. Students or their parents must belong to a union affiliated with the Chicago Federation of Labor and may apply in only one of the two categories. The period for submitting applications is January 1 through March 1. Please see the application for complete instructions.
